+Q: Is this a virus?
|
|
|
+A: Cgminer is being packaged with other trojan scripts and some antivirus
|
|
|
+software is falsely accusing cgminer.exe as being the actual virus, rather
|
|
|
+than whatever it is being packaged with. If you installed cgminer yourself,
|
|
|
+then you do not have a virus on your computer. Complain to your antivirus
|
|
|
+software company.
